Having only owned the Vee for a couple of months, the novelty of a loud exhaust is wearing thin. I'm struggling to know what to get to find that perfect balance. I don't want to replace a loud roar with another equally loud roar.
 
Try and track down a plastic bulkhead?

Oh and the quietest aftermarket I heard was the ktec backbox (doesn't seem to be available new anymore). No drone or real noise at cruising speed; a little roar above 4000rpm. Definitely louder than standard but was too quiet for me !!

Am I right in thinking that the current K-Tec system and the current Janspeed (NOT the ph2 group buy from Spike, but the same as the ph1 he has offered just above) are one and the same?? I believe this to still be the case.
 
the KTEC one is definately the same as I fitted both to my phase 1 and phase 2. Can't comment on the Janspeed. Quicksilver is also the same and fits both the phase 1 and 2.

Think I'm the only one with the FOX Andy. Well made bit of kit from the German manufactures. Bit louder than OEM but still easy on the ear drums for the longer drives. Wasn't sure with the blanking plate provided so modified a second hand bumper.
